Description
These dumpling lasagna cups are a fun and comforting twist on classic lasagna, layered with savory beef, creamy cheeses, and rich tomato sauce, all baked into perfectly portioned crispy-edged cups.
Ingredients
Scale
- 24 dumpling wrappers
- 250 grams ground beef
- 1 cup tomato sauce
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1/4 cup grated parmesan cheese
- 1/2 cup ricotta cheese
- 1 small onion, finely ch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 180°C and lightly grease a muffin tin.
- Heat olive oil in a pan, cook onion and garlic until soft, then add ground beef and cook until browned.
- Stir in tomato sauce,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per, then let simmer briefly.
- Press dumpling wrappers into each muffin cup to form small cups.
- Add a spoon of meat mixture, a layer of ricotta, and a sprinkle of mozzarella.
- Repeat layers once more in each cup.
- Bake for 15 to 20 minutes until cheese is melted and edges are golden.
- Sprinkle parmesan on top, let cool slightly, then remove and serve.
Notes
- Do not overfill the cups to avoid spilling while baking.
- Let them cool slightly before removing to help them hold shape.
- You can substitute ground beef with chicken or turkey.
- Add fresh herbs on top for extra flavor.
